Understanding PPC Advertising
Before delving into the PPC agency vs. in-house debate, let's briefly define PPC advertising. PPC is an online advertising model where advertisers pay a fee each time their ad is clicked. It's a popular method for driving targeted traffic to websites, as ads are displayed to users searching for specific keywords.
The Role of a PPC Agency
What Is a PPC Agency?
A PPC agency is a specialized firm that offers professional pay-per-click advertising services to businesses. These agencies consist of experienced PPC experts who manage and optimize your ad campaigns across various platforms like Google Ads and Bing Ads.
The Benefits of Hiring a PPC Agency
1. Expertise and Specialization
PPC agencies are laser-focused on managing pay-per-click campaigns. They possess in-depth knowledge of the latest industry trends and best practices, ensuring your campaigns are optimized for maximum ROI.
2. Time Savings
By outsourcing PPC management to an agency, you free up valuable time to concentrate on core business activities, leaving the complexities of campaign management to the experts.
3. Access to Advanced Tools
PPC agencies have access to cutting-edge tools and technologies, which can lead to more effective campaign optimization and performance tracking.
4. Scalability
Agencies can quickly scale your advertising efforts up or down based on your business needs, ensuring flexibility in your marketing strategy.
Potential Drawbacks of PPC Agencies
1. Cost
Hiring a PPC agency can be expensive, with fees typically tied to ad spend. Small businesses with limited budgets may find this cost-prohibitive.
2. Less Control
You may have less control over the day-to-day management of your campaigns when working with an agency, which can be a concern for some businesses.
Building an In-House PPC Team
What Is an In-House PPC Team?
An in-house PPC team is a group of dedicated professionals employed directly by your company to handle all aspects of pay-per-click advertising.
Advantages of an In-House Team
1. Full Control
With an in-house team, you have complete control over your campaigns, strategies, and decision-making processes.
2. Brand Understanding
In-house teams have an intimate understanding of your brand and business goals, which can lead to more tailored and brand-aligned campaigns.
3. Cost Efficiency (Long-term)
While initial setup costs may be higher, in-house teams can be cost-effective in the long run, especially for businesses with substantial ad spend.
Challenges of In-House PPC Management
1. Recruitment and Training
Building a competent in-house team requires time and effort to recruit, train, and retain skilled professionals.
2. Limited Expertise
In-house teams may lack the extensive expertise and resources that PPC agencies offer, especially for complex campaigns.
